Win32 Disk Imager is a popular tool targeted at the Windows platform. Version 0.9 of the tool can also flash older legacy systems such as Windows XP and Vista.
10 Best Rufus Alternatives for Windows, Linux, and macOS - Beebom
Win32 Disk Imager is one of the oldest programs for flashing low-level utilities like Raspbian and ARM-based operating systems on SD cards and USB sticks. In true sense, Win32 Disk Imager is a Rufus alternative because the performance is exceptionally great and the flashing speed is in its own league.
